I was wondering if people who took the test could comment on whether they felt the QR section more closely resembled the DAT Destroyer QR section (in the back, about 150 problems) or the Math Destroyer. I am referring to both level of difficulty and range of topics.
As I've seen other forum members discuss, the DAT Destroyer QR is a lot easier than the Math Destroyer and for non math guys (of which there are many) that's a big deal. If the QR is like DAT Destroyer, I'm not bad. If it's like Math Destroyer, I have so much more work to do. Any ideas?
Thanks
 
The problems in the DAT Destroyer are on the easy side (a good number of them anyway). I think you should definitely consider the Math Destroyer if you're not strong in math. The actual DAT is somewhere in the middle of the Math Destroyer. While there are easy problems on the DAT itself, you want to prepare for the worst. If you have a good handle on Math Destroyer, you will probably do very well in the actual DAT.
